Class of 2018 RB Christian Turner commits to Michigan

Michigan lands another commitment out of Georgia.

Jim Harbaugh has continued to make some major noise on the recruiting trail in SEC country.

Three-star RB Christian Turner announced his commitment today.

Turner is 5-foot-11, 187 pounds and a three-star running back out of Buford, Georgia, according to 247Sports. This announcement comes after several crystal ball predictions were submitted over the last few days, including the predictions on April 9 by Tom Loy with 247 Sports Notre Dame and Recruiting Director, Steve Wiltfong.

His list of 26 offers include several in the Big Ten offers with Minnesota, Nebraska, Northwestern, Purdue, Rutgers, and Wisconsin. He received his Michigan offer in February then visited Ann Arbor on April 6. From March 28 through April 7, he had unofficial visits to Alabama, Wisconsin, Norte Dame, Michigan and Michigan State.

Turner makes it Michigan’s second commit from the state of Georgia in the last four days after four-star cornerback, Myles Sims, announced on April 7. The 2018 class includes three commitments from Georgia out of the five so far. Full 2018 Michigan recruiting class list on 247 Sports.
